What to look for when hiring a plumber in Frederick

  • Verified license and insurance. Delaware requires a general contractor license for most trade work, always ask to see it.
  • Written estimates. Any plumber who won't put the scope in writing is a red flag.
  • Review quality, not just volume. Read the 3-star reviews, they're usually the most honest.
